Depending on the setup and tune, I've seen 430-450 whp on stock fueling system and 93 octane (with maybe a touch of e85 for octane boost) at about 18 psi. It's a nice route to go if you don't want to mess with PI and just want some more power up top... with room to upgrade the power later on. Last edited by F30_SixSpeed; 08-17-2017 at 07:09 AM.. |

Are you PWG with stock turbo, XDI 35 and breaking up? Something wrong then! I could run 17-18psi with PS2 on stock fuel system. HPFP would dip to ~1200psi but car ran fine.
